What is the ruling on insurance in America if a Muslim is given the choice between lying to obtain free treatment, or subscribing to a commercial insurance company (which involves Maysir), or paying for treatment costs through a usurious contract?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
A Muslim is not permitted to engage in forbidden acts such as lying, commercial insurance, and usury when there is ease and choice. However, if one is in need or compelled to seek treatment and cannot afford hospital expenses except by subscribing to health insurance, then there is no blame upon him in that, for Allah Almighty says: "And He has not placed upon you in religion any difficulty," and "So fear Allah as much as you are able." The came to avert and minimize evils, and health insurance in this case is lesser of an evil than lying and usury.
